About Pullman, MI's
Pullman is a small unincorporated community located in Allegan County in the state of Michigan. Established primarily as an agricultural area, Pullman has a rich history tied to the farming and railroad industries that once thrived in the region. It is situated in a scenic part of Michigan, surrounded by forests and farmlands, which adds to its rural charm.

The Economy of Pullman, MI
The economy of Pullman, Michigan, is predominantly based on agriculture, with a significant emphasis on fruit farming and other crop production. The community's economic activities are closely linked to the seasonal cycles of planting and harvest, making it an integral part of the region's agricultural sector. Additionally, local small businesses and services cater to the needs of residents and contribute to the local economy.

Understanding the BLS and Inflation in Pullman, MI
The Bureau of Labor Statistics (BLS) is a government agency that collects and analyzes economic data across the U.S., including cities like Pullman, MI. One of its key responsibilities is tracking inflation through the Consumer Price Index (CPI), which measures how the cost of everyday goods and services changes over time. Inflation can impact everything from housing prices to the cost of groceries, gas, and utilities across the area. By tracking inflation, the BLS helps people from Pullman, MI understand how their purchasing power is affected and provides insights for businesses and policymakers.
